What Do Guttering Contractors Do?
Guttering contractors specialize in the installation, maintenance, and repair of gutter systems. Their expertise encompasses different tasks connected to rainwater management, including:
Installation: Guttering contractors examine a home's requirements and set up suitable gutter systems, making sure correct slope and alignment for reliable water overflow.Cleaning: Regular cleaning of gutters is necessary to prevent obstructions and overflows. Contractors often supply this service, ensuring that leaves, particles, and silt are cleared routinely.Repairs: Damaged gutters can cause significant concerns, consisting of water ingress and structure issues. Contractors recognize problems and carry out required repairs to bring back performance.Replacement: When gutters end up being too worn or harmed, contractors will change them, often advising the best materials based upon a property owner's spending plan and visual preferences.Assessment: Routine inspections can avoid little problems from intensifying. 1. How frequently should gutters be cleaned up?
It is normally advised to clean gutters at least two times a year, specifically in spring and fall when leaves and debris are most likely to collect.
2. What products are used for gutters?
Typical products consist of vinyl, aluminum, steel, and copper. Each product has its advantages and downsides concerning expense, resilience, and maintenance.
3. How do I know if my gutters need repairs?
Signs consist of water overflow during rain, sagging gutters, noticeable rust or corrosion, and water marks on the home's outside.
4. What is the typical expense of gutter installation?
The expense of gutter installation differs based upon numerous aspects, consisting of product choice, home size, and the complexity of the task. Generally, homeowners can expect to pay between ₤ 1,000 to ₤ 2,500.
